The high levels of H2S
contamination of sewage gas from sludge digesters is now of great concern. Severe and expensive damage has occurred at many sites to top end engine bearings, exhaust gas heat exchangers, even those manufactured from stainless steel and boiler back end tube plates.
Not only does the cost of repairs have to be borne, instead of selling power to the grid, expensive power has to be bought in. |

Capital and running costs for GASRAP are much cheaper than those for wet systems. A much more flexible system GASRAP only needs to function when H2S levels exceed the safe working maximum for your engine thereby prolonging the intervals between GASRAP recharging. GASRAP module on farm location. The CHP unit on this farm uses BIOGAS made from farm bi-products. Here the biogas levels were reduced from 4000 ppm down to under 400ppm. |
